Incoterms are commonly shown on a commercial invoice to clarify delivery terms, cost responsibility, and risk transfer, usually as the rule plus the named place or port and the version, such as FOB Shanghai, Incoterms 2020. They are not a universal one-line legal requirement in every market, but many customs, importer, and shipping workflows expect them. When finance teams review incoterms on commercial invoices, the job is not just to confirm that a term appears. They also need to confirm that the wording matches the agreed shipment terms, the freight and insurance presentation, and the surrounding shipping documents.
That distinction matters because the real question is not "Should we print an Incoterm somewhere?" It is "Will everyone reading this invoice interpret responsibility, cost allocation, and supporting documents the same way?" An invoice that says CIF Hamburg, Incoterms 2020 tells a different operational story than one that says FCA Shenzhen, Incoterms 2020, even if the goods description and total amount look similar.
For most teams, the safest approach is to treat commercial invoice Incoterms as a document-control field. The term helps AP, logistics, customs brokers, and suppliers read the transaction consistently, but it does not override the purchase contract, local import rules, or carrier-specific documentation requirements. Some markets or buyers explicitly require delivery terms on the invoice. Others may accept invoices that rely on the purchase order or shipping instructions for that detail.
The practical work is fourfold: write the term in a complete format, interpret the charges correctly, match the invoice against the rest of the shipment file, and catch exceptions before approval or dispatch. That is where most invoice disputes and landed-cost errors start.
How to Write the Incoterm Correctly on the Invoice
The clearest format is rule + named place or port + version. For example:
- FOB Shanghai, Incoterms 2020
- CIF Hamburg, Incoterms 2020
- FCA Seller's Warehouse, Birmingham, Incoterms 2020
That structure identifies the rule, shows the point in the transport chain that matters, and removes doubt about which version of the International Chamber of Commerce framework the parties are using.
The named place on a commercial invoice is not a cosmetic detail. "FOB" alone leaves too much room for interpretation because readers still need to know which port is being referenced. The same problem shows up with FCA and DDP when the place is omitted. Without the named location, finance teams can misread where responsibility changes, customs teams can misread the shipment context, and suppliers can argue later that the invoice reflected a different understanding than the order.
Version labeling matters for the same reason. According to Trade.gov's Incoterms overview, parties can keep using an agreed Incoterms version after 2020 if the chosen version is clearly identified on export-related documents, and each Incoterm rule states the seller's responsibility to provide the commercial invoice in conformity with the contract of sale. That means the invoice should mirror the agreed commercial term rather than improvise a shorthand label that only the issuing party understands.
In practice, good wording looks like a direct copy of the agreed term. Weak wording usually falls into one of these patterns:
- Too short: "FOB" or "CIF" with no place and no version
- Too vague: "terms of trade as agreed"
- Potentially inconsistent: a term on the invoice that differs from the purchase order or shipping instruction
If your team standardizes nothing else, standardize this field. A complete Incoterms 2020 commercial invoice label is one of the fastest ways to reduce ambiguity before the invoice reaches customs, AP, or the customer.
What FOB, CIF, CFR, FCA, and DDP Change for Invoice Interpretation
Once the term is written correctly, the next question is what it tells you about the invoice. The main value is interpretive. The term helps you understand who arranged or paid for parts of the movement, what cost signals you should expect on the document, and where risk transfer sits in the transaction. It does not turn the invoice into a full legal file, but it gives finance teams a framework for reading it.
Here is the practical view:
- FOB: Often read as a shipment where the seller handles obligations up to loading at the named port. If the invoice uses FOB wording, readers should not assume inland freight, ocean freight, or insurance are all embedded in the goods value.
- CIF: Signals a different expectation because cost and insurance are handled differently for the named destination. A CIF invoice may lead reviewers to expect that freight and insurance responsibility are reflected in the commercial arrangement even if the invoice still separates some charges for clarity.
- CFR: Similar to CIF in that transport cost expectations differ from FOB, but insurance treatment is not the same. That distinction matters when reviewers try to infer whether an insurance line should exist.
- FCA: Often used where handoff happens earlier in the chain, so invoice reviewers should pay close attention to the named place and to whether transport beyond that point belongs inside the supplier's charges.
- DDP: Usually signals a broader seller obligation, which can change how readers interpret freight, duties, and downstream landed-cost assumptions.
This is why FOB vs CIF invoice wording is not a trivial wording choice. The term shapes landed cost invoice interpretation because readers use it to infer what should already be priced into the sale and what should appear elsewhere in the transaction record. It also helps separate cost responsibility from risk transfer. Those ideas often move together in conversation, but they are not identical, and treating them as the same can produce the wrong approval decision.
When reviewing the invoice, ask a simple question: does the term make the presentation of goods, freight, insurance, and destination logic look coherent? If not, the invoice needs clarification before anyone relies on it for approval or customs support.
Which Charges Belong in the Goods Value and Which Should Stay Separate
Incoterms do not force every supplier into one invoice layout, but they do affect how you interpret the numbers on the page. A reviewer should separate the goods value from any separately stated freight, insurance, duties, handling fees, or service charges, then ask whether that presentation fits the agreed delivery term.
For example, one invoice may present a single goods amount with no freight line because transport is handled outside the supplier bill. Another may show goods and freight separately even though the seller is responsible for arranging transport under the agreed term. That is not automatically wrong. Separate lines can still support the commercial arrangement. What matters is whether the presentation is internally consistent and usable for approval, accruals, and customs support.
This is where customs invoice delivery terms become operational rather than theoretical. Customs valuation rules can vary by jurisdiction, importer status, and the way supporting documents are filed. So the commercial invoice should support the declared treatment, not rely on a blanket assumption that every country reads freight, insurance, and seller-paid charges the same way.
A useful review sequence is:
- Identify the agreed Incoterm, named place, and version.
- Read the goods value separately from any freight or insurance lines.
- Check whether those lines make sense under the stated term.
- Compare the invoice against the purchase order, shipping instruction, and customs paperwork if valuation depends on how charges are shown.
The goal is not to prove customs law from the invoice alone. It is to avoid avoidable misreads. If the term suggests seller-paid freight but the invoice presentation leaves freight responsibility unclear, that gap can distort landed cost, delay approval, or trigger follow-up questions from brokers and finance reviewers.
Keep the Invoice Aligned With Packing Lists, Bills of Lading, and Purchase Data
An Incoterm becomes far more useful when it matches the rest of the shipment file. The commercial invoice should tell the same operational story as the packing list, bill of lading, purchase order, and any customs-facing declarations. If those records diverge, reviewers waste time deciding which document reflects the real agreement.
At a minimum, compare these points across the file:
- seller and buyer identities
- shipment description and quantities
- named place or port
- freight and responsibility cues
- dates and reference numbers that tie the documents together
This is why it helps to understand how packing lists differ from commercial invoices. The packing list may focus on physical shipment detail while the invoice focuses on commercial value, but the Incoterm should still fit the same delivery narrative. If the invoice says CIF Hamburg and the surrounding documents imply a different handoff point, the mismatch needs explanation before approval.
The same principle applies to transport records. Teams that already know how bills of lading fit into document matching workflows are usually quicker to spot when the invoice term, named destination, or freight presentation no longer lines up with the shipment record. Those inconsistencies may lead to customs questions, supplier disputes, or rework inside AP because the invoice cannot be reconciled cleanly.
Think of the term as a shared reference point across the file, not as a standalone label. If the invoice is the only document carrying one version of the trade term while the purchase order or transport records suggest another, the problem is not just wording. It is control failure across the transaction packet.
Common Mistakes That Cause Disputes, Delays, or Misstated Costs
Most Incoterms invoice requirements problems come from incomplete wording or weak document discipline, not from obscure trade-law edge cases. A few mistakes account for most of the downstream friction.
- Missing named place or port: A term like FOB or FCA without the location invites arguments about where responsibility changes.
- Missing version: If the parties rely on an earlier edition, the invoice needs to say so clearly rather than assuming every reader will default to 2020.
- Mismatch with the commercial agreement: The invoice should reflect the purchase order or contract, not introduce a different term at billing stage.
- Treating the term as a full customs answer: The invoice may show the delivery term, but importer rules, carrier templates, or country-specific requirements can still demand additional documentation logic.
- Ignoring charge presentation: If the term and the freight or insurance lines tell different stories, landed-cost assumptions can go wrong quickly.
These errors have practical consequences. A buyer may dispute an invoice because the term suggests one allocation of freight while the line items suggest another. AP may hold the invoice because it cannot reconcile the stated delivery term with the order. Customs or broker teams may ask for clarification because the document bundle does not support the declared transaction cleanly.
Receiving-side checks can expose the same weaknesses. If your workflow includes document checks around goods receipt, it helps to know what delivery notes confirm during goods receipt. The delivery note, transport documents, and invoice do not serve the same purpose, but they should still support the same shipment narrative. If one record suggests a different destination, handoff point, or responsibility split, the review team needs to resolve that before the file moves forward.
The safest habit is to treat exceptions as part of the process. Importer instructions, carrier formats, and local rules can override generic best practice. A good review workflow does not assume the Incoterm line alone settles the issue.
A Review Checklist for Sending or Approving a Commercial Invoice
Before the invoice leaves your team, or before you approve a supplier invoice for processing, run through a short checklist:
- Confirm the full term is written clearly. Use the rule, the named place or port, and the version.
- Match the wording to the agreement. The invoice should reflect the purchase order or contract, not a shorthand variation added later.
- Read the numbers through the term. Check whether goods value, freight, and insurance presentation make sense for the stated delivery terms.
- Match the shipment file. The invoice, packing list, bill of lading, and customs-facing records should point to the same commercial story.
- Check for local or buyer-specific exceptions. Importer instructions or country rules may require more than generic Incoterms best practice.
- Resolve ambiguity before approval. If the term, the named place, or the charges are unclear, get clarification before the invoice enters AP, customs, or reconciliation workflows.
That is the practical standard. You do not need to memorize every rule from the International Chamber of Commerce to review a commercial invoice well. You need the document set to be complete, internally consistent, and clear enough that another team can rely on it without guessing.
Teams that formalize these checks inside invoice data extraction workflows can reduce repetitive comparison work across invoices and shipping documents, but the same checklist still applies: write the term completely, read the charges in context, and verify that the surrounding documents support the same transaction.
About the author
David Harding
Founder, Invoice Data Extraction
David Harding is the founder of Invoice Data Extraction and a software developer with experience building finance-related systems. He oversees the product and the site's editorial process, with a focus on practical invoice workflows, document automation, and software-specific processing guidance.
Profile
View author pageEditorial process
This page is reviewed as part of Invoice Data Extraction's editorial process.
If this page discusses tax, legal, or regulatory requirements, treat it as general information only and confirm current requirements with official guidance before acting. The updated date shown above is the latest editorial review date for this page.
Related Articles
Explore adjacent guides and reference articles on this topic.
Packing List vs Invoice: Key Differences Explained
Learn how packing lists and invoices differ in purpose, fields, and workflow use, and why mismatches create customs, receiving, and AP issues.
Bill of Lading Automation: OCR, Extraction, and Matching
Learn how bill of lading automation captures shipment data, validates exceptions, and supports freight invoice matching, audit, and downstream handoffs.
Landed Cost Allocation in Manufacturing: A Guide
Guide to allocating freight, duty, and brokerage to inventory in manufacturing, including allocation methods, late-charge reconciliation, and document workflows.
Invoice Data Extraction
Extract data from invoices and financial documents to structured spreadsheets. 50 free pages every month — no credit card required.